BICC Export/Import of Customization
We currently use the Export and Import Customization features to migrate PVO BICC changes between environments, and while this works well, it is less than I believe it should be.
For example, if you are altering a job in which you have multiple PVO's. and you removed a pvo from the job. Exporting the configuration and importing it to another environment where that Job was previously defined, will result in that PVO still being in that Job definition.
It is behaving as if all imports are additive only, what I would like is to see it be a replacement. I.e. Remove the existing job and create a new job based on the Customization file I am importing.
The same conditions exist for column removal, etc. It has gotten to the point where if I am altering a pvo in any manner, I export it from the source environment, log into the target environment and manually delete the job and its schedules prior to importing the same job/schedules.
I fully understand trying to be nondestructive in operations, but there should be a way to change that behavior on an import basis.
